ELEMENTS OF DESIGN
Not Shown
The student did the minimum or the artwork was never completed
Emerging
The assignment was completed and turned in, but showed little evidence of any understanding of the elements and principles of art; no evidence of planning.
Progressing
The student did the assignment adequately, yet it shows lack of planning and little evidence that an overall composition was planned.
Accomplished
The artwork shows that the student applied the principles of design while using one or more elements effectively; showed an awareness of filling the space adequately.
Exceeding
Planned carefully, made several sketches, and showed an awareness of the elements and principles of design; chose color scheme carefully, used space effectively.
Creativity/Originality
Not Shown
The student showed no evidence of original thought
Emerging
The student fulfilled the assignment, but gave no evidence of trying anything unusual. Used a safe solution, but did not stretch limits.
Progressing
The student tried an idea, but it lacked originality; substituted "symbols" for personal observation; might have copied work.
Accomplished
Tried a few ideas before selecting one; made decisions after referring to one source; solved the problem in logical way
Exceeding
Explored several choices; generated many ideas; made connections to previous knowledge; demonstrated an understanding of problem solving skills.
Effort/Perseverance
Not Shown
The student did not finish the work adequately.
Emerging
The project was completed with minimum effort.
Progressing
The student finished the project, but it could have been improved with more effort; adequate interpretation of the assignment, but lacking finish; chose an easy project and did it indifferently.
Accomplished
The student worked hard and completed the project, but did not push beyond the minimum requirements.
Exceeding
The project was continued until it was complete as the student could make it; gave it effort far beyond that required; to pride in going well beyond the requirement.
Craftsmanship/Skill
Not Shown
The student showed poor craftsmanship; evidence of lack of effort or lack of understanding.
Emerging
The student showed below average craftsmanship, lack of pride in finished work.
Progressing
The student showed average craftsmanship; adequate, but not as good as it could have been, a bit careless.
Accomplished
With a little more effort, the work could have been outstanding; lacks the finishing touches.
Exceeding
The artwork was beautiful and patiently done; it was as good as hard work could make it.
Use of Class Time
Not Shown
Did not use class time to focus on project OR often distracted others
Emerging
Used some class time well. There was some focus on getting project done but occasionally distracted others.
Progressing
Work pace needs to be improved. Does not distract others, but needs to accomplish more.
Accomplished
Used time well during each class period. Usually focused on getting project done and never distracted others
Exceeding
Used time well during each class period. Focused on completing project and never distracted others.
